Dodgers Snag 4-2 Win
The Los Angeles N (SS-A) Dodgers had to overcome a fine effort from Milwaukee (SS-A) pitcher Jim Patin to grab a narrow 4-2 win at Ballpark of Conshohocken. Patin went 7.1 innings and allowed 1 run. With the victory, the Dodgers record now stands at 16-5.

Had Francisco Cedeno not delivered a key base hit in the bottom of the eighth, the outcome might have been different. Instead, with two down and runners on 2nd and 3rd, Cedeno hit a 2-run single. That made the score 4-2, in favor of the Dodgers.

"This team keeps racking up the wins," said Dodgers manager Noah Grills.
